Weather in November

The last month of the autumn, November, is another hot month in Pirara, Guyana, with temperature in the range of an average high of 33.5°C (92.3°F) and an average low of 23.9°C (75°F).

Temperature

Upon the onset of November, Pirara witnesses an average high-temperature of a still hot 33.5°C (92.3°F), showing a close resemblance to the prior month. The low-temperature averages to a warm 23.9°C (75°F) during the nights of November.

Heat index

During November, the heat index is calculated to be a blisteringly hot 44°C (111.2°F). Precaution: Heat cramps along with heat exhaustion are possible. Heatstroke is a serious risk with continued exertion.
Heat index specifics point out values are for conditions of shade and a slight breeze. Direct sunlight can potentially bo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', marries air temperature and humidity to produce a value illustrating perceived warmth. The influence of weather can be personal, changing with an individual's body mass, height, and level of physical exertion. Direct sunlight exposure should be noted as it has the potential to increase the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Younglings frequently fail to recognize the requirement to rest and rehydrate. Thirst emerges late in dehydration - it is imperative to keep hydration levels high, particularly during extended physical exertions.
The body's natural response to excessive warmth is perspiration, as it allows for cooling through sweat evaporation. Under high air temperature coupled with high humidity (high heat index), the body's perspiration is reduced, intensifying the sensation of heat. When body heat isn't effectively managed, risks of dehydration and overheating amplify.

Humidity

In November, the average relative humidity in Pirara is 67%.

Rainfall

In Pirara, during November, the rain falls for 15.1 days and regularly aggregates up to 50mm (1.97")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 204.4 rainfall days, and 941mm (37.05")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through August, October through December are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The average length of the day in November is 11h and 58min.
On the first day of November, sunrise is at 05:42 and sunset at 17:41.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:49 and sunset at 17:45 -04.

Sunshine

In Pirara, the average sunshine in November is 9h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Pirara are January through May, July through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: During November, 7 as the daily maximum UV index converts into the following advice:
Eschew overexposure. Those with light skin may suffer bur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Remember that UV radiation from the Sun is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Make an effort to limit direct sun exposure during this time. Opt for tightly woven and loose clothing to enhance protection from the Sun.
